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$1,286 per month in Tbilisi vs $1,395 in Pabianice, rent included.

A couple spends around $2,044 per month in Tbilisi vs $2,058 in Pabianice, rent included.

A family of three spends $2,802 per month in Tbilisi vs $2,721 in Pabianice, rent included.

Tbilisi is about 8% cheaper than Pabianice,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.

Tbilisi sits 6% below the global median, while Pabianice is 2% above –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.
